SBR

Sabine Royalty Units Stock

StockStock
ISIN: US7856881021
Ticker: SBR
US7856881021
SBR

Price

Historical dividends and forecast

All dividend data

Sabine Royalty Units has so far distributed $4.626 in 2024. The next dividend will be paid on 29.11.2024


$2.963

CHART BY

Frequently asked questions

What is Sabine Royalty Units's market capitalization?

The market capitalization of Sabine Royalty Units is $910.48M. Market capitalization is a measure of the total market value of a publicly traded company. It is calculated by multiplying the current stock price by the total number of outstanding shares.

What is Sabine Royalty Units's Price-to-Earnings (P/E) ratio?

The Price-to-Earnings (P/E) ratio (TTM) for Sabine Royalty Units is 10.20. This ratio helps investors assess whether a stock is overvalued or undervalued compared to its earnings.

What is the Earnings Per Share (EPS) for Sabine Royalty Units?

Sabine Royalty Units's Earnings Per Share (EPS) over the trailing twelve months (TTM) is $6.123. EPS indicates the company's profitability on a per-share basis.

What is Sabine Royalty Units's revenue over the trailing twelve months?

Over the trailing twelve months, Sabine Royalty Units reported a revenue of $92.54M.

Is Sabine Royalty Units paying dividends?

Yes, Sabine Royalty Units is paying dividends. The next payment is scheduled for 29.11.2024, with an expected amount of .

What is the EBITDA for Sabine Royalty Units?

Sabine Royalty Units's Earnings before interest, taxes, depreciation, and amortization (EBITDA) over the trailing twelve months is $89.28M. EBITDA measures the company's overall financial performance.

What is the free cash flow of Sabine Royalty Units?

Sabine Royalty Units has a free cash flow of $837.25K. Free cash flow indicates the cash generated after accounting for cash outflows to support operations and capital assets.

What is the 5-year beta of Sabine Royalty Units's stock?

The 5-year beta for Sabine Royalty Units is 0.48. A beta value indicates the stock's volatility relative to the market; a beta greater than 1 means higher volatility.

What is the free float of Sabine Royalty Units's shares?

The free float of Sabine Royalty Units is 14.04M. Free float refers to the number of shares available for public trading, excluding restricted shares.

Financials

Market Cap

 
$910.48M

5Y beta

 
0.48

EPS (TTM)

 
$6.123

Free Float

 
14.04M

P/E ratio (TTM)

 
10.20

Revenue (TTM)

 
$92.54M

EBITDA (TTM)

 
$89.28M

Free Cashflow (TTM)

 
$837.25K

Pricing

52W span
$57.73$72.50

Information

Sabine Royalty Trust (the Trust) is an express trust. The Trust receives a distribution from Sabine Corporation (Sabine) of royalty and mineral interests, including landowner’s royalties, overriding royalty interests, minerals (other than executive rights, bonuses and delay rentals), production payments and any other similar, non-participatory interest, in certain producing and proved undeveloped oil and gas properties located in Florida, Louisiana, Mississippi, New Mexico, Oklahoma and Texas (the Royalty Properties). The Royalty Properties are the only assets of the Trust, other than cash being held for the payment of expenses and liabilities and for distribution to the unit holders. The trustee of the Trust is Argent Trust Company, a Tennessee chartered trust company.

Misc. Financial Services

Energy

Identifier

ISIN

US7856881021

Primary Ticker

SBR
Join the conversation